Posted on: Thursday, 24 July 2008, 00:00 CDT By Vicki Mathias; Lynne Hutchinson v.mathias Health minister Dawn Primarolo has spoken of her determination to target happy hours in an attempt to cut the pounds2.7 billion cost of drink problems to the NHS. Details of a consultation were revealed as it emerged that 811,000 or six per cent of hospital admissions in 2006 nationally were alcohol-related. Figures published in May showed that in the Bristol PCT area there were 2,302 hospital admissions due to alcohol in 2006/07, 892 in South Gloucestershire and 805 in North Somerset. Bristol South MP Ms Primarolo, in her capacity as public health minister, wants to make a code for licensees to become mandatory and not voluntary, to restrict the way alcohol is sold.
